How does the law treat Penn State and other state-affiliated universities?

Financial disclosures. State-related universities, such as Temple University, The University of Pittsburgh, The Pennsylvania State University, and Lincoln University are required to make public annual reports, which must include the following:

  • Information contained in Form 990 of the IRS (except for individual donor information);
  • The salaries of all officers and directors; and
  • The highest 25 salaries paid to employees.

Effective Date. These provisions take effect on July 1, 2008.
